You're almost ready to start caulking, but let me give you a few tips first. First, use clear silicone. It's much nicer than white silicone, and, if you apply it in a thin clean line it takes on the color of whatever surface you apply it to, which ensures an exact colour match. WebTo get those kinds of joints, you can use green painters’ tape to mask off your joints. You should leave 1/8 to 3/16 of an inch gap on each side of the caulk seam. The goal is a caulk joint that is ¼” to 3/8 of an inch wide. Make your tube opening small – When you cut the tube opening, keep the tip opening small. WebMar 29, 2024 · Caulk is an umbrella term for a number of sealing agents, ranging from an array of materials from silicone, latex or acrylic. Generally, caulk is applied the same way that sealant is applied-using a caulking gun to repair cracks or join surfaces together. WebApr 5, 2024 · Bathtub repair costs $100 to $300 on average for minor surface issues such as fixing chips and cracks, caulking and resealing to prevent leaks, and plumbing problems. Repairing major surface damage costs $200 to $1,200 for refinishing the tub enamel or repainting the tub a new color.
